{"id":23051,"date":"2026-02-18T16:47:42","date_gmt":"2026-02-18T23:47:42","guid":{"rendered":"https:\/\/woodriverweekly.com\/?p=23051"},"modified":"2026-02-21T16:48:36","modified_gmt":"2026-02-21T23:48:36","slug":"a-humbled-cowboy","status":"publish","type":"post","link":"https:\/\/woodriverweekly.com\/index.php\/2026\/02\/18\/a-humbled-cowboy\/","title":{"rendered":"A HUMBLED COWBOY"},"content":{"rendered":"<p>I woke up with a mighty thirst that water could not slake. To quench my thirst, a soda pop, is just what it would take.<br \/>\nI headed down to Merkle\u2019s store. The time was eight o\u2019clock. I said good morning to the clerk. He turned and what a shock.<br \/>\nThe young man stood there out of place, his bull ring was impressive. It pierced his nose, hung to his lip. Did that mean he\u2019s aggressive?<br \/>\nI must admit I was confused. A bull ring for your nose? I\u2019ve seen bulls bellow out with pain as their ring came to a close.<br \/>\nWe gave each other searing stares. I swear he stared right through me. Did he see me as I saw him? Dang sure a mystery.<br \/>\nI stood there with my cowboy hat, pulled way down past my ears. A toothpick hanging out my mouth. He hadn\u2019t seen that for years.<br \/>\nI asked the clerk, \u201cYou got a name?\u201d He said, \u201cMy name is Lee. I moved here from the city and you\u2019re not too sure of me.\u201d<br \/>\nAn answer shot right out my mouth. \u201cYou\u2019re some kind of picture. City boy with a bull-ring nose. A statement with a mixture.\u201d<br \/>\nLee said, \u201cI\u2019m looking strange to you, I guess I\u2019m out of place. But where I\u2019m from you\u2019d be the one who\u2019d claim stares to his face.<br \/>\nLee said, \u201cYour drink is free today. You want a soda pop?\u201d He took my mug and poured some ice, then filled it to the top.<br \/>\nHe really got me thinking. It made a lot of sense. Tomorrow when I buy a pop, I won\u2019t be so intense.<br \/>\nMy father taught me his own rules. I\u2019m reminded of this one. Treat every person with respect. They\u2019re, too, a mother\u2019s son.<br \/>\nI said, \u201cI\u2019d like to make you welcome, from a fool who\u2019d be a friend. Let\u2019s shake and start this over, we can get this on the mend.\u201d<br \/>\nI left there feeling humbled and a little bit contrite. But feeling warmth all over from an act that turned out right.<\/p>\n<p>\u2013 Bryce Angell<\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p>\u2013 Bryce Angell<\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>I woke up with a mighty thirst that water could not slake.
